The anti-inflammatory action of C. sativa extracts was examined on three traces of epithelial cells and on colon tissue in a very product of inflammatory bowel illnesses (IBDs), where C. sativa bouquets have been extracted with ethanol, located the anti-inflammatory action of Cannabis extracts derives from THCA present in fraction seven (F7) of your extract. Having said that, all fractions of C. sativa at a specific mixture of concentrations exhibit an important greater cytotoxic action and suppress COX-two and MMP9 gene expression in both mobile society and colon tissue, advise the anti-inflammatory activity of Cannabis extracts on colon epithelial cells derives from a portion in the extract that contains THCA, which is mediated, at the very least partly, through GPR55 receptor.

The initial cannabinoid the plant will create is CBGA, also known as the “mom of all cannabinoids” because it can eventually break down and generate Main cannabinoids, like THCA and CBDA.

Owing to mild, oxygen, etcetera., some slight decarboxylation will manifest naturally, but Generally, when we would like one of the most strong flower, we have to use hands-on approaches.
